Some tips for your application 🫡

Understand the Role: Read the job description carefully to understand the responsibilities and requirements of the Chef Operative position. Tailor your application to highlight relevant experience in food preparation and kitchen operations.

Craft a Strong CV: Ensure your CV is up-to-date and clearly outlines your culinary skills, previous work experience, and any relevant qualifications. Use bullet points for clarity and focus on achievements that demonstrate your capabilities as a Chef Operative.

Write a Compelling Cover Letter: In your cover letter, express your enthusiasm for the role and the company. Mention specific reasons why you want to work with this leading manufacturer of chilled foods and how your skills align with their values and culture.

Proofread Your Application: Before submitting your application, take the time to proofread all documents. Check for spelling and grammatical errors, and ensure that your contact information is correct. A polished application reflects your attention to detail.

How to prepare for a job interview at Job&talent

✨Know Your Culinary Skills

Make sure to brush up on your cooking techniques and culinary knowledge. Be prepared to discuss your experience with different cuisines, food safety standards, and any specific skills that are relevant to the role of a Chef Operative.

✨Understand the Company Culture

Research the company’s values and work environment. Since the client promotes open communication and a positive atmosphere, think about how you can contribute to this culture and be ready to share examples from your past experiences.

✨Prepare for Practical Questions

Expect questions that assess your problem-solving abilities in a kitchen setting. You might be asked how you would handle a busy service or resolve conflicts with team members, so have some scenarios in mind to demonstrate your skills.

✨Dress Appropriately

Even though it’s a kitchen role, first impressions matter. Dress smartly for the interview to show that you take the opportunity seriously. Consider wearing something that reflects your personality while still being professional.
